The Artistry and Legacy of André Derain

André Derain was a central figure in the Fauvist movement, often referred to as one of the 'wild beasts' of modern art alongside Henri Matisse. His work is celebrated for its bold, non-naturalistic use of color and expressive brushwork. In this piece, Derain’s mastery of light and form is evident, bridging the gap between impressionistic observation and avant-garde abstraction. Who was the artist André Derain and why is he significant?

André Derain was a French artist and co-founder of Fauvism. He is famous for pioneering the use of bold, vibrant colors and simplified forms, fundamentally changing the trajectory of 20th-century modern art.

What is the significance of the Baker's Hotel series in art history?

Baker's Hotel reflects Derain's focus on structured urban landscapes. It highlights his transition from the explosive colors of pure Fauvism toward a more geometric and deliberate style influenced by classical French traditions.
